AI Summary

The first World Humanoid Robot Games kicked off in Beijing, featuring over 500 robots competing in various events, from athletics to practical tasks. While some robots struggled with basic movements, others demonstrated impressive speed and agility. Although still far from human-level athleticism, the games highlight China's focus on robotics development as a national strategy.
